Parking Lot Leveling in Cleveland, TN
Parking lot leveling services involve adjusting the surface of existing parking areas to create a smooth, even surface. This process is commonly requested for commercial properties, apartment complexes, and private driveways that have developed uneven spots, potholes, or slopes over time. Property owners typically seek this service to improve safety, prevent vehicle damage, and enhance the overall appearance of their parking spaces. Before requesting parking lot leveling, it is important to understand the current condition of the surface, including the extent of unevenness and any underlying issues such as drainage problems or base instability.
Projects covered by parking lot leveling can vary from minor surface adjustments to more extensive repairs that require soil stabilization and base reconstruction. Property owners often want to know if their existing pavement can be restored or if it needs replacement, as well as the best methods to address specific issues like sinking or cracking. Clarifying these details helps determine the most appropriate approach for achieving a level, durable parking surface that meets safety and usability standards.

Common Parking Lot Leveling Jobs
Parking lot leveling involves smoothing uneven surfaces to improve safety and usability.
Surface correction addresses cracks and dips for a more even parking area.
Asphalt leveling restores the proper slope and prevents water pooling.
Concrete leveling raises sunken sections to create a flat, stable surface.
Driveway leveling helps maintain proper drainage and extends pavement lifespan.
